Senior Ball - Saturday, June 5th
Currently, the Class of 2021 Senior Ball will be held on Saturday, June 5th @ Schroeder HS. This will be an outdoor event under party tents. The current DOH guidelines and the large size of our senior class do cause some limits. Due to this, we currently will only be able to allow members of the Class of 2021 from Schroeder HS to attend. Junior Prom - Friday, June 4th
Currently, the Class of 2022 Junior Prom will be held on Friday, June 4th @ Schroeder HS. This will be an outdoor event with party tents. The current DOH guidelines and the large size of our junior class do cause some limits. Due to this, we currently will only be able to allow members of the Class of 2022 from Schroeder HS to attend. Schroeder Speech & Debate Team wins GVFL League championship
Schroeder Speech & Debate Team wins GVFL League championship again this year, claims several individual championships and qualifies 8 for nationals!
National qualifiers are as follows:
Emma C. in Declamation
Lauren B. in Oral Interpretation
Sophia V. in Original Oratory
Luke P. in Lincoln-Douglas Debate
Felix H. & Jason L. in Public Forum Debate
Kenny R. & Andrew G. in Student Congress
Individual champions: Lauren B., Sophia V., Felix H. & Jason L.
2nd place league champions: Andrew G., Kenny R., Luke P., Emma C. Russell G.

Schroeder Teacher Accepts College Board Advisor Position
Mathematics & Computer Science teacher Mrs. Sage Miller has been offered and has accepted a position as a College Board Advisor of the College Board Advanced Placement Computer Science A Development Committee for the 2021-2022 academic year. This is a one year appointment with the possibility of renewal after the first year of service for up to two additional years. Congratulations Mrs. Miller!
